Synopsis
Pope Joan, directed by Sรถnke Wortmann, is a historical drama that tells the fascinating and controversial story of a woman who disguised herself as a man and rose to become the Pope in the 9th century. The film brings to life the journey of Johanna, portrayed by Johanna Wokalek, as she navigates the challenges of the medieval Roman Catholic Church while concealing her true identity. With captivating performances and stunning cinematography, Pope Joan delves into themes of gender equality, power, and religion. As Johanna's secret becomes increasingly precarious, the movie unfolds a gripping tale of deception, ambition, and faith.

Reviews
Pope Joan has garnered mixed reviews from critics. While some praise the film for its compelling narrative and strong performances, others criticize its historical inaccuracies and pacing. Critics from Rotten Tomatoes commend the movie for its unique portrayal of a lesser-known historical figure, giving it a rating of 3.5/5. IMDb users have rated Pope Joan 6.7/10, with many highlighting the captivating storyline and emotional depth. However, Metacritic reviews point out the disjointed plot and inconsistent character development, awarding the film a score of 55/100. Overall, Pope Joan offers a thought-provoking exploration of gender and power dynamics within the Church, but falls short in certain aspects according to critics.
